Top Desert Destinations Around the World

For those eager to experience the vast beauty of deserts, here are some top destinations:
- Joshua Tree National Park, California: Characterized by the iconic Joshua Trees and unique rock formations, this park is perfect for hiking, climbing, and enjoying exquisite sunsets.
- Atacama Desert, Chile: Known as one of the driest places on Earth, the Atacama has remarkable landscapes filled with salt flats, geysers, and volcanoes.
- Wadi Rum, Jordan: This stunning desert playground offers not just rugged environmental beauty but also insane rock formations, ancient nomadic tribes’ culture, and adrenaline-pumping motorcycle adventures.
- Namib Desert, Namibia: Famous for its surreal red sand dunes, this desert is a photographer’s paradise, offering unique compositions at sunrise and sunset.
Preparing for Your Desert Adventure

As exhilarating as desert exploration can be, it’s crucial to unprepared beforehand to ensure a safe and enjoyable experience. Here are some tips to help get you ready:
- Stay Hydrated: Desert climates can get exceedingly hot and dry. Carry sufficient water to avoid dehydration. A good rule is one gallon per person per day.
- Wear Appropriate Clothing: Light-colored, loose-fitting clothes are ideal for deflecting the sun’s rays. A wide-brimmed hat is also helpful for sun protection.
- Sun Protection: Use sunscreen with high SPF and protective eyewear to guard against harmful UV radiation.
- First Aid Kit: Ensure your first aid kit is packed and consider additional items like lip balm to combat dryness and blister aids if hiking.
